logo

Output 17b5b9cc3a21aef9b7bddd87a814f629f212907a930a5683efee38370a453637:1

value
4366410652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02c359b2a5c1c5cb13c8d6da65384942a67f737a OP_EQUAL
address
31wdJ7L32dwzN5V9PKcgsQUjrQEq19JwwC
transaction
17b5b9cc3a21aef9b7bddd87a814f629f212907a930a5683efee38370a453637